Hearts have rubbished reports claiming goalkeeper Sammy Adjei has been transfer-listed.
Adjei, 32, has falling down the perking order with reports in the local media à on Thursday suggesting the 32-year was deemed surplus to requirement.
But the clubââ¬â¢s goalkeepersââ¬â¢ trainer Abubakar Damba has moved swiftly to debunk the reports insisting the former Ashdod last line of defense remains an intergral part of the teamââ¬â¢s rebuilding exercise.

Head coach David Duncan has embarked on a massive clear-out which has seen 12 players being told to look elsewhere.
